Wholesale - What to do with a old seller carry back note???

Edward Mccracken
  • Real Estate Investor
  • Sauk Village, IL
Posted Jul 7 2015, 03:54

I found a homeowner thats is dying to get out of his house.... Here are some quick facts that are verified through the recorder of deeds:
Mortgage company released the mortgage on his house for 75k
Banks around here sometimes just release the loans instead of foreclosing on them. lol...
House has 6k of unpaid real estate taxes.
House has about 5k to be fixed up. 
After the house is fixed up its worth 20k
There is  a seller carry back mortgage of 6k that was from 2005 and was to be paid off in 
2009.  The terms were not very descriptive all it says was it had to be paid off in 2009.  
The owner said he only made 3 payments.  

My question is what do I do about this seller carry back?  I'm pretty sure the builder that gave the seller carry back went bankrupt, but the seller carry back mortgage is in a personal name.
